Reborn baby dolls are incredibly realistic dolls that mimic the appearance and feel of real infants. Designed with meticulous detail, these dolls are crafted to evoke the warmth and innocence of a newborn. For beginners, understanding what makes reborn dolls special is essential. These dolls are typically made from high-quality vinyl or silicone, allowing for lifelike skin textures, tiny veins, and even subtle imperfections that mirror real babies. Artists often paint these dolls with layers of translucent colors to create realistic skin tones and add delicate features like tiny eyelashes and realistic hair, which can be rooted or painted.
Many enthusiasts collect reborn dolls for various reasons—some as artistic expressions, others for therapeutic purposes, or simply as collectibles. The process of creating a reborn doll involves several steps, including assembling the doll’s body, painting realistic skin details, adding rooted hair, and dressing the doll in tiny, adorable clothes. For beginners, starting with a pre-made kit or a partial kit can be a great way to learn the craft before venturing into full customization.
